Output bf53a7446104d70045981e94de161dcfd00803c331d777ae750f1588bd96fecd:1

value
1082464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5edaa6500e08606133a2d8347edb9f355b93c7 OP_EQUAL
address
3JxKGNtGvDDU4d8qz9pwh7DqYw3fY2S3Jh
transaction
bf53a7446104d70045981e94de161dcfd00803c331d777ae750f1588bd96fecd
confirmations
250571
spent
true